Coverdale said, "I am shocked, very disappointed and surprised by Mr. Turner's misleading and completely untrue observations he felt it necessary to discuss in a recent interview. Whatever his motives, they are disturbing, to say the least.
"I do not 'mime' in concert. I never have and I never will... I am David Coverdale. My career spans almost 40 successful years and I have worked with some of the finest musicians in contemporary music and in all that time I have never 'pretended' to sing to tapes when I am performing in front of a paying crowd. - more on this story
